Wang Jue
Wang Jue is the director of the International Cooperation and Exchange Office at Dalian University of Technology, China. He has been instrumental in fostering educational exchanges between China and Southeast Asian countries, facilitating programs that enhance cross-cultural understanding and cooperation in higher education.
